FREEDOM OF INFORMATION ACT 2000 - request for information.
I acknowledge your request for information received on 29th March 2011.
Your request is being considered and you will receive a full response to
your request, within the statutory timescale of 20 working days (from the
day after the request is received) as defined by the Freedom of
Information Act 2000.
If appropriate, the information may be provided in paper copy, normal font
size. If you require alternative formats, e.g. language, audio, large
print, etc. then please let me know.
The Act defines a number of exemptions, some of which are subject to a
public interest test that may prevent release of the information. You will
be informed if this is the case, and you have a right to appeal against
our decision. Information relating to this will be included in any refusal
notice issued.
If the information you request contains reference to a third party then
they may be consulted prior to a decision being taken on whether or not to
release the information to you.
There may be a fee payable for this information. This will be considered
and you will be informed if a fee is payable. In this event the fee must
be paid before the information is processed and released. The 20 working
day time limit for responses is suspended until receipt of the payment.
